Mastodon Share
Sharing on Mastodon:



https://multiup.io/download/f4b9393cc9a90298787144916cda4aa0/[FFA] 100-man no Inochi no Ue ni Ore wa Tatteiru - 09 [1080p][HEVC][Multiple Subtitle].mkv

HomeAbout